Now that you have created your Categories, you can use YaBB's amazing Board-creation utilities to manage the postable sections of your community. YaBB allows you to create an unlimited* number of boards in every category. In order to access these functions, you must be logged in as an Administrator or Global Moderator with proper access rights. Once you are, look at the main menu. You will notice a link titled "Admin Center". Clicking this will bring you to a large control panel. On the left hand menu, search for the section titled "Forum Controls" and click on the second link titled "Boards".
* YaBB is only limited by the space allocated to you on your web hosting server.

$SectionBody2 = qq~YaBB gives admins the ability to add multiple Boards from a single screen. To do this, access the forum's Board Management functions as explained above. Once there, scroll to the bottom of the list of existing boards (if any) and find the function titled "Add Boards". Enter the number of new Boards you would like to create in the text box then press the button titled "Add".
On this Edit Boards page, you will be given a large set of options for each of the new Boards you are trying to add:
- Board ID
- This is only used for internal YaBB functions, and it is used in the URL used to view a board. You may enter any alphanumeric name you wish with no spaces.
- Name
- This is what your users will see as the name of the Board. You may enter anything you wish here.
- Description
- Describe this board so your users will know what the subject/topic will be.
- Moderators
- Click on the link under the word "Moderators" to add the members you wish to give Moderator access for this board.
- Membergroup Moderators
- If you choose to have all the members of one or more particular Member Groups act as Moderators for this board, select the Member Group(s) here.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: If you set up a particular Member Group and assign it as the Membergroup Moderator group in a Board, it is easy to add a new Moderator to that Board - just add them to that Member Group.
- Category
- Choose which Category you would like this board to be a part of.
- Board Picture
- Here you can assign a small image to represent this board. Type the complete URL to the image in this box using the standard format: http:www.domain.com/folder/imagename.jpg. Allowed image formats are .gif, .jpg, .png, and .bmp.
- Zero Post Count Board?
- Check this box if you would like to prevent any Posts made in this Board from increasing users' Post Counts.
- Show to All?
- Checking this option will ensure the Board Name and Board description are shown to all who are able to view the Category this Board is in, even if they are not allowed access to view the contents of the Board itself.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: This is a good way to show your Guests that there is more content available to them if they register and become Members.
- Allow Attachments
- Checking this option will enable users to attach files to their posts in this board provided the "Allow File Attaching in Posts?" option is checked in the Admin Center/Forum Configuration/Advanced Settings under the "File Attachments" tab.
- Global Announcements
- Checking this option will ensure the messages in this board are shown as important on top of every board. No matter how the Board permissions are set, only Administrators and Global Moderators can start new topics or reply. Note: YaBB only allows a single board to have this label.
- Recycle Bin
- Checking this option make this board a recycle bin for messages deleted by moderators. It can also be used as a recycle bin for Administrators by unchecking the box found in the Admin Center/Configuration/Forum Settings under the "Staff" tab. Note: YaBB only allows a single board to have this label.
- Minimum Age to Access
- Restrict access by minimum age.
- Maximum Age to Access
- Restrict access by maximum age.
- Gender Allowed Access
- Restrict access by gender.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: The Age/Gender restrictions are based on the information users enter in their Profile for birthday and gender selection. If a user does not enter an age or select a gender, YaBB has no way to know their age or gender, thus they will not be allowed access to any board that uses these restrictions.
- Allowed to Start Topics
- Limit which Member Groups can start a new topic.
- Allowed to Reply to Topics
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to reply to topics.
- Allowed to View Topics
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to view topics.
- Allowed to Create Polls
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to create polls.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: To allow Guests to do any of the above four functions, do not select any member groups in that option box.
Once you have filled out all the information for your new Boards, scroll down to the bottom of the list and click on the button titled "Save". Your new Boards will be created and opened for posting!

$SectionBody3 = qq~If you need to make changes to any of the boards you have created, simply follow the directions above to access your board management section. In the list of boards, you will notice a check box that corresponds to each title. Check this box for each and every board you wish to edit. Once selected, scroll to the bottom of the board listings and locate the set of radio buttons titled "With Selected:". Click on the radio labeled "Edit" then press the button to the right titled "Go".
On this Edit Boards page, you will be given a large set of options for each of the new Boards you are trying to edit:
- Board ID
- This is only used for internal YaBB functions, and it is used in the URL used to view a board. This Board ID is not editable and is displayed for information only.
- Name
- This is what your users will see as the name of the Board. You may enter anything you wish here.
- Description
- Describe this board so your users will know what the subject/topic will be.
- Moderators
- Click on the link under the word "Moderators" to add the members you wish to give Moderator access for this board.
- Membergroup Moderators
- If you choose to have all the members of one or more particular Member Groups act as Moderators for this board, select the Member Group(s) here.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: If you set up a particular Member Group and assign it as the Membergroup Moderator group in a Board, it is easy to add a new Moderator to that Board - just add them to that Member Group.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: You can also assign Moderators and Moderator Groups to a specific board by going to that board and clicking on the 'Add/Delete Moderators' link near the top or by going to the Admin Edit section of a member's Profile and choosing the board or boards you would like them to Moderate.
- Category
- Choose which Category you would like this board to be a part of.
- Parent Board
- Choose which board you would like this board to be a subboard of.
- Child Boards
- Tells you what boards are already subboards within this board.
- Can Post?
- Choose whether or not topics within this board can be viewed.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: If this is a new/empty board no topics can be posted to it. Post can only be made to the subboards within it. If this board has threads, making it an 'No Post' board means the threads will become inaccessable even to the admin.
- Board Picture
- Here you can assign a small image to represent this board. Type the complete URL to the image in this box using the standard format: http:www.domain.com/folder/imagename.jpg. Allowed image formats are .gif, .jpg, .png, and .bmp.
- Zero Post Count Board?
- Check this box if you would like to prevent any Posts made in this Board from increasing users' Post Counts.
- Show to All?
- Checking this option will ensure the Board Name and Board description are shown to all who are able to view the Category this Board is in, even if they are not allowed access to view the contents of the Board itself.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: This is a good way to show your Guests that there is more content available to them if they register and become Members.
- Allow Attachments
- Checking this option will enable users to attach files to their posts in this board provided the "Allow File Attaching in Posts?" option is checked in the Admin Center/Forum Configuration/Advanced Settings under the "File Attachments" tab.
- Global Announcements
- Checking this option will ensure the messages in this board are shown as important on top of every board. No matter how the Board permissions are set, only Administrators and Global Moderators can start new topics or reply. Note: YaBB only allows a single board to have this label.
- Recycle Bin
- Checking this option make this board a recycle bin for messages deleted by moderators. It can also be used as a recycle bin for Administrators by unchecking the box found in the Admin Center/Configuration/Forum Settings under the "Staff" tab. Note: YaBB only allows a single board to have this label.
- Enable Board Rules
- Check this box if you would like to enable Board Rules for this board.
- Allow Collapse?
- Check this box if you would like users to be able to collapse the Board Rules.
- Rules Title
- Title for the rules for this board.
- Board Rules
- Rules for this board. You may use html tags in the rules.
- Minimum Age to Access
- Restrict access by minimum age.
- Maximum Age to Access
- Restrict access by maximum age.
- Gender Allowed Access
- Restrict access by gender.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: The Age/Gender restrictions are based on the information users enter in their Profile for birthday and gender selection. If a user does not enter an age or select a gender, YaBB has no way to know their age or gender, thus they will not be allowed access to any board that uses these restrictions.
- Allowed to Start Topics
- Limit which Member Groups can start a new topic.
- Allowed to Reply to Topics
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to reply to topics.
- Allowed to View Topics
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to view topics.
- Allowed to Create Polls
- Limit which Member Groups are allowed to create polls.
ADMINISTRATOR TIP: To allow Guests to do any of the above four functions, do not select any member groups in that option box.
Once you have edited all the information for your Boards, scroll down to the bottom of the list and click on the button titled "Save". Your changes to the Boards will be seen immediately.

$SectionBody4 = qq~If you would like to remove a Board, follow the directions in the Accessing the Board Functions section above to access your Board management page.
Deleting a Board
- In the list of Boards, you will notice a check box that corresponds to each title. Check this box for each and every Board you wish to remove.
- Once selected, scroll to the bottom of the Board listings and locate the set of radio buttons titled "With Selected:".
- Click on the radio labeled "Remove" then press the button to the right titled "Go".
- A small pop-up will ask you to confirm that you want to remove these Boards. Click "OK" to remove them or "Cancel" to keep them
